This Google Charts 3D pie chart highlights the UK job market trends for several roles relevant to this postgraduate certificate. It captures the average salary ranges to provide you with an understanding of the industry landscape and potential career paths. 1. **Natural Resource Manager**: As a natural resource manager, you'll oversee the development and implementation of strategies to ensure efficient and sustainable use of natural resources. The average salary for this role in the UK is around £65,000 per year. 2. **Environmental Consultant**: In this role, you'll provide advice and guidance to businesses and organizations on environmental issues, risks, and compliance. The average salary for environmental consultants in the UK is approximately £48,000 per year. 3. **Ecotourism Planner**: Ecotourism planners work on developing and managing sustainable tourism activities, ensuring minimal impact on the environment. The average salary for this role in the UK is around £55,000 per year. 4. **Conservation Scientist**: As a conservation scientist, you will focus on preserving and managing the natural environment, wildlife, and natural resources. The average salary for this role in the UK is around £39,000 per year. 5. **Wildlife Biologist**: Wildlife biologists study animals and wildlife habitats to understand their behaviors, interactions, and threats. The average salary for wildlife biologists in the UK is approximately £35,000 per year.
